Biografia

Spanish writer-director and producer, burst onto the American film scene with his riveting directorial debut TIMECRIMES, which premiered at Austin's Fantastic Fest in 2008. The film went on to win critical acclaim at major festivals, winning the coveted Best Feature Film at Fantastic Fest before being released in theaters by Magnolia Pictures.

Vigalondo went on to write, direct and produce EXTRATERRESTRIAL, which was released in U.S. theaters by Focus Features. In 2014, he premiered OPEN WINDOWS, starring Elijah Wood and Sasha Grey, at South by Southwest, where it was nominated for the Audience Award. The film also screened at the Toronto After Dark Film Festival, winning the Best Editing Award. Additionally, the film was nominated for a Goya Award for Best Special Effects.

Vigalondo has won more than 80 awards in national and international film festivals. In 2005, his feature short "7:35 in the Morning" was nominated for an Oscar for Best Short Film in addition to a European Film Award.
